Input validation error in Microsoft Exchange Server - CVE-2023-38182

Published: August 8, 2023


Vulnerability identifier: #VU79150
CSH Severity: Medium
CVSS v4: 8.6 [CVSS:4.0/AV:A/AC:L/AT:N/PR:L/UI:N/VC:H/VI:H/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]
CVE-ID: CVE-2023-38182
CWE-ID: CWE-20
Exploitation vector: Adjecent network
Exploit availability: No public exploit available

Vulnerability details

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code on the system.

The vulnerability exists due to insufficient validation of user-supplied input in Microsoft Exchange Server. A remote user on the local network can pass specially crafted input to the application and execute arbitrary code on the system.


Affected software

Microsoft Exchange Server

How to mitigate CVE-2023-38182

Install updates from vendor's website.

Microsoft Exchange Server - addressed in versions 2016 CU23 Aug23SU 15.01.2507.031, 2019 CU12 Aug23SU 15.02.1118.036, 2019 CU13 Aug23SU 15.02.1258.023
